Reproducible Novel Transcriptional Differences Between Psoriatic Lesional and Non-Lesional Skin Show Increased Inflammation and Metabolism.

Abstract

BACKGROUND

Psoriasis is a common but complex chronic inflammatory skin Disease. Array-based studies can help identify therapeutic targets.

OBJECTIVE

To reproducibly assess single-gene transcriptional changes in psoriatic skin.

METHODS

We evaluated 210 top candidate genes from a first psoriasis study group (population 1), and then confirmed differential expression in a second independent psoriasis study group (population 2).

RESULTS

One hundred and thirty-eight differentially expressed genes were replicated in the 2 studies, of which 57 have not previously been reported as associated with psoriasis. This is significantly greater than the 10 expected false positives. Lesional skin vs uninvolved areas showed inflammatory and cell regulation changes.

CONCLUSION

Previously undescribed psoriasis-associated genes revealed in this study may provide potential future targets for development and assessment of novel therapeutic agents for psoriasis.
